Decide what note you want to be the tonic, Using the chromatic scale, follow the major scale interval pattern of whole steps and half steps to list out all the notes in the major scale of the note you chose as the tonic, Determine what scale degree each note resides on, Build 3-note chords for each note in the major scale by stacking the 3rd and 5th intervals on top of each note, List out the chord names of the major key, using the Roman Numeral method above to differentiate between major, minor, and diminished chords.
